Subject: Image slimming handoff

Hi all — quick heads-up before the audit. I'm rotating off the Pennyworth container-slimming effort to focus on the Driftline migration, so ownership of the distroless base images and the layer-pruning pipeline is moving. The trimmed images drop our attack surface a lot (no shell, no package manager), but the CVE-scanning exceptions list still needs a second pair of eyes — flagging that for your review. Effective Monday, all questions about the slimming pipeline should go to the person named below.

named custodian: Brivan Eliath Quenox Frador

## Deployment

The Quillbarrow tax-rate cache runs as a single stateless pod per region and warms itself from the Ledgerline rates API on boot. Warm-up takes about ninety seconds; the readiness probe stays red until the cache hits 95% coverage. Deploys are rolling, one region at a time, starting with the Harwick cluster. If rates look stale after a deploy, flush and redeploy rather than patching in place. The values the pod boots with are listed below.

config for tagep-yajef:
ulawyn:
  log_level: error
  metrics_host: metrics.ulawyn.lumiclabs.internal
  pin: 0564
  pool_size: 32

**Title:** Duplicate charges on payment retry — idempotency keys not honored

On the Tollgrove checkout service, retries triggered by gateway timeouts are generating fresh idempotency keys instead of reusing the original one, so the processor treats each retry as a new charge. For context (you're new here): keys are minted in `payments/session.py` and should persist for the full attempt chain. Reproduced twice on staging. The affected build is recorded below.

pipeline stamp: htk31_f769b577b3028a4e9958e5bb8d1259a